Agreed, those manual Classic 900's are in huge demand. Depends on condition. Here is what I usually send people that ask me this question:
My usual advice is to see what others are asking and what has sold in the classifieds so check out the current ads for your model category. Here is the classifieds index page:
http://www.saabnet.com/tsn/class/
Also, at the top of every for sale model page, there is a link to past sold listings that have historical selling data (when owners notify me that their car has sold) going back to 2007. See if that helps too.
http://www.saabnet.com/tsn/class/900pclass.html
Do NOT use KBB.com or NADA.com. They no longer have accurate information regarding used Saab pricing.
